Return of Ultraman (1971) - Ultra Retrospective (Remake)
Welcome to Ultra Retrospective, a webseries where I talk about the various Ultraman shows I've seen over the years. In this video I talk about the 1971 series Return of Ultraman, an entry conceived in Eiji Tsuburaya's final years that went on to influence the rest of Ultraman's Showa era.
